Dundrum
GFC Club Notes.
* The Seniors
returned from
the July break
with two encouraging
wins over Teconnaught
and Ardglass.
On Monday night
past they took
on St Pauls at
home while this
Friday they travel
to Ballynoe to
take on Bright.
Next up after
this is the eagerly
anticipated Championship
encounter against
Teconnaught in
Downpatrick on
Saturday the 11th.
* The Reserves
have still yet
to get a win in
the EDRFL this
season. On Sunday
they were well
beaten 2-15 to
1-09 by a more
experienced and
clinical Castlewellan
III's. On a more
positive note
though the team
did win the 2nd
half by a point.

* The U-16's romped
in to the Semi
Finals of the
East Down B Championship
after a fantastic
1-16 to 1-06 win
over St Johns
at Dundrum on

* Congratulations
to the St Josephs
U-14 team who
lifted the Damien
McCashin Shield
over the July
holidays. A victory
over Ardglass
in the Semi Final
led to a great
3-02 to 3-01 win
over Bright in
the Final. Well
done to the Dundrum
representatives
on the team: Conn
Rooney (captain),
Deaghlan Cunningham,
Oisin McKibbin
and Rory Kavanagh.
